Subject: DR drill Thursday — profile store resharding

Hi all,

Welcome to the team. This Thursday we run the quarterly disaster-recovery drill for the Ostveil user-profile store. We will simulate losing shard group B and rehearse splitting profiles across the new Kembrook ring using the resharding runbook. Expect read-only mode for about an hour in staging only; production is untouched. New folks should shadow a shard captain and take notes. To open the rehearsal vault containing the shard manifests, use the passphrase below.

unlock words, yawig-kagef: gordor-holvan-ulaael-pramir-ulaiel-tamdor

Ticket: Drift on points-ledger config. Hey — noticed the loyalty-points ledger in prod is running different rounding and accrual caps than what we reviewed last sprint. Looks like someone hot-patched during the Brightmart promo and never backported. Can you sanity-check before I realign? Here's what prod is actually running right now.

config for bagep-kageg:
ULADOR_LOG_LEVEL=warn
ULADOR_METRICS_HOST=metrics.ulador.tolvaqcorp.corp
ULADOR_POOL_SIZE=32

Runbook: GarageGlance occupancy feed

If the Harborview Deck occupancy feed goes stale (no updates for 5+ minutes), first check the sensor gateway health page. Green but stale usually means the aggregator queue is backed up; restart the aggregator via the ops console and counts should recover within two minutes. If spots show negative numbers, force a full recount from the camera snapshots. When escalating to engineering, include the trace token shown below.

session token of yawif-kahof = htk9_dd6996ed6

# Runbook: Hunting leaked file descriptors in Quillgate

When the `fd_open` gauge climbs steadily between deploys, suspect a leak rather than load. First confirm on a single pod: exec in and count entries under `/proc/1/fd`, noting how many are sockets in CLOSE_WAIT versus regular files. Capture two snapshots ten minutes apart before restarting anything — we need the delta for the postmortem. Reproduce locally with the Marbury load harness, which requires the service running with the following configuration values.

settings of yagep-bajog:
[istdor]
port = 4000
region = south-2
host = istdor.qorvelcorp.internal
timeout_ms = 5000
retries = 5